If a mixture of CO and N₂ in equal amount have total 1 atm pressure, then partial pressure of N₂ in the mixture is
Options
(a) 1 atm
(b) 0.50 atm
(c) 2 atm
(d) 3 atm
Correct Answer:
0.50 atm
Explanation:
Partial pressure of a component = Mole fraction × Total pressure
pɴ₂ = (Number of moles of N₂ / Total number of moles) × 1
pɴ₂ = (1 / 2) × 1 = 0.5 atm
